Which side of the plane has the best views landing at Lubbock International (LBB)?

When landing at Lubbock International (LBB), sit on the Right side for the best views. Lubbock's primary runways (16/34) mean most approaches come from the north or south. A right-side seat gives you views of the flat High Plains terrain and the town of Lubbock itself as you descend, plus the distinctive runway layout and surrounding agricultural grid. Left side faces mostly open plains with fewer visual references. Notable sights include: Lubbock city grid and downtown area, Texas Tech University campus (recognizable by its layout), Yellowhouse Draw drainage pattern to the east, rectangular agricultural fields of the South Plains.
